Repurposing Ideas

Chandeliers can be repurposed into various useful items that can serve different functions. These ideas include:

Plant Holder

If you have an old chandelier, you can repurpose it into a plant holder. You can remove the bulbs and wiring, spray paint the fixture in your desired color and hang small pots of plants from each arm of the chandelier. This idea is perfect for those with limited space looking to add some greenery to their home without cluttering it.

Bathroom Towel Holder

You can repurpose a small chandelier into a bathroom towel holder. This idea is ideal for those who prefer vintage elegance in their homes. You can use the arms of the chandelier to hang towels instead of the traditional towel bar. You can also add a few hooks or hangers on the base of the chandelier to hold additional towels.

Jewelry Holder

An old chandelier can be repurposed into a unique jewelry holder. You can use the arms of the chandelier to hang necklaces and bracelets for an organized display. You can also attach small hooks or hangers on the base of the fixture to hold rings and earrings. This idea is perfect for keeping jewelry neat and tidy while adding an element of elegance to your space.

Revamping Ideas

If you have a chandelier that you love, but the design does not fit your decor, consider revamping it into a new design that fits your style. Here are some ideas:

Painting the Chandelier

A simple way to revamp a chandelier is by painting it in a color that matches your decor. You can spray paint the fixture for an even finish. Bold colors, like electric blue or bright yellow, can add a pop of excitement to the room, while muted tones, like gray or off-white, can blend in with the decor while still maintaining the elegance of the chandelier.

Adding Shades

You can add shades to the bulbs of your chandelier to change the look and feel of the room. Shades come in various colors, shapes, and sizes. You can choose shades that complement your decor or go with a bold statement piece. Adding shades can also diffuse the light and create a softer ambiance in the room.

Replacing the Crystals

Chandeliers with crystals add a touch of luxury and glam to any room. However, if the crystals have faded, you can replace them to restore the fixture’s original glory. You can purchase new crystals online or at a local lighting shop. Installing new crystals can be a tedious process, but the result is worth the effort.
